Learn how to design more effective marketing strategies by understanding the fundamental differences between how individuals and corporations make purchasing decisions. This course contrasts the personal decision-making of consumers with the complex, group-based buying processes common in business environments, revealing the distinct behaviors and functions of each. By the end of this course, you will be able to tailor your marketing approach to successfully account for the unique motivations of both consumer and business buyers.

    • In this course, we'll learn about buyer behavior - both from an individual and corporate perspective. Once you've identified whether you are marketing to consumers directly or to other businesses, it's important to understand how the buying process works. Whereas consumers often make decisions individually or in small groups, that is often not the case for a business. We'll learn about the behaviors and functions that make up these differences and how to account for those when designing your marketing strategy.
